Default Florida Registration

What a difference a coast makes.

Walked into the Florida tag office on Friday with my California title, VIN verification document, and proof of Florida insurance. Walked out 15 minutes later with my "Antique" designation Florida plate and my "1965 Ford" registration.

Had to make a prior 10 minute stop to get the VIN verification document.
